Help a homebound elder become less lonely by becoming a Phone-A-Friend. Bilingual volunteers needed.

Phone-A-Friend volunteers provide a social connection and wellness checks for homebound, low-income seniors. Volunteers are assigned to one or more homebound seniors to make calls on a regularly scheduled basis. Services are offered 7 days a week, excluding holidays, between 9:00 am and 9:00 pm.

Volunteers contact their assigned seniors on the mutually agreed upon schedule to make sure that the seniors are able to answer the phone; and to provide telephone social support to reduce loneliness and a wellness check. The program helps seniors maintain their independence and ability to live at home and reduces social isolation and loneliness.

Mission Statement

Catholic Charities Hawai'i, rooted in the gospel of Jesus, exists to carry out the social mission of the church by serving the people of Hawai'i, regardless of their faith or culture.

Description

Serving Hawai'i since 1947, Catholic Charities Hawai’i provides a wide range of social services with dignity, compassion, social justice, and a commitment to excellence. Through programs and advocacy efforts, Catholic Charities Hawai’i serves all people, especially those with the greatest need, regardless of their faith or culture.

As part of the largest private network of social service organizations in the United States, Catholic Charities Hawai'i offers much needed programs and services statewide, serving tens of thousands of people each year.

REQUIREMENTS

  • Background Check
  • Must be at least 18
  • Orientation or Training
  • Allow two (2) hours for safety checks, when needed. Calls usually last 15 to 60 minutes. Call days & time range are mutually agreed upon by the volunteer & senior receiving calls. This is an on-going program. Minimum time commitment: one (1) year.
  • Volunteers provide social support & a wellness check during the call. Be able to communicate clearly over the phone. Great listener; patient. Must maintain client confidentiality, provide monthly reports & attend virtual meetings & trainings.
